Know before you go
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Nyholms Fort.
- Visit during the early morning or late afternoon to enjoy fewer crowds and a more peaceful experience.
- Don’t forget to bring your camera to capture the stunning views of the surrounding sea and landscapes.
- Wear comfortable shoes, as exploring the fort involves walking on uneven surfaces.
- Check for guided tour schedules to gain deeper insights into the fort's history.
- Consider visiting during the summer months when the weather is milder and ideal for outdoor exploration.

Getting There
-
Walking
Start from the center of Bodø, particularly from the Bodø Bus Station. Head south on Storgata towards Rådhusgata. Continue straight until you reach the waterfront, where you will see the Bodø Harbor. Walk along the harborfront towards the east, enjoying the view of the sea and the surrounding mountains. After about 15 minutes, you will reach a small ferry terminal called 'Nyholmen'. Here, you can catch a ferry that goes directly to Nyholms Fort. The ferry ride will take approximately 5 minutes.
-
Ferry
Once you arrive at the Nyholmen ferry terminal, board the ferry to Nyholms Fort. The ferry is typically marked with signs indicating its destination. Enjoy a scenic ride across the water. Upon arrival at Nyholms Fort, disembark and follow the pathways leading to the fort, which is a short walk from the ferry landing.
